Researching the following families:
in Hudson County, New Jersey mid 1800's Patrick Kenney (b. abt. 1812 in Co. Galway Ire.) married Catharine Thorp (b. abt. 1819 in Co. Kildare Ire.) and their son Martin(b. abt. 1856 in Ossining, NY) who settled in Hoboken, NJ during the 1880's.
Anthony Dunleavy and Margaret Quinlan from Mayo, Ireland to Pontefract, Yorkshire, England and their son Christopher(b. abt. 1862) who immigrated to Hoboken.
Patrick Conway and Johanna Wallace from Ireland who's daughter, Mary Ellen(b. abt. 1866) was the wife of Christopher Dunleavy.
Nicholas McKeon(b. 1847) and Roseanna McCudden(b. 1849) from Co. Louth. Ireland to NYC and Hoboken, NJ.
in Upstate New York 1800's
Elijah Sprague(b. abt 1790) and Betsey Bailey (b. abt. 1793 in Long Island) in Gilboa, Schoharie Co.
Joseph Gray(b. 1818) and Mary Lonsbery(b. 1821) in New Berlin, Chenango Co.
John Moore(b. 1815 in Eng.) and Ann Sills(b. 1815 in Eng.) in Pittsfield, Otsego Co.
Thomas Otto Robbins(b. 1868, s.o Benjamin Robbins and Marian Foster) and Ida Frink(b. 1870, d.o. Francis Frink and Eliza Cooley) in Plymouth/Pharsalia/Otselic, Chenango Co.
Feliks Popkowski(b. 1887 s.o. John Popkowski and Ustysia Wtolkowska) and Alexandra Kowalczyk(b. 1886 d.o. Stanley Kowalczyk and Mary Paliwoda) from Maly Plock, Lomza (Podlaskie) Poland to Syracuse.
